    This new generation really think they can just "pick up" the shoulder roll. How many fighters have we seen at the highest level use it effectively? The list is short, Mayweather and Toney. Floyd was a damn prodigy and was literally born into it and Toney is probably one of the most natural fighters in recent memory.

    Floyd made this generation think it looks cool so they want to do with without having the discipline, reflexes, instincts, etc to use it. Also, Floyd mixed in other guards with his shoulder roll and Ryan is an idiot.
